📝 Description: Exploring Dark Short Fiction #1: A Primer to Steve Rasnic Tem Guignard, Eric J

For over four decades, Steve Rasnic Tem has been an acclaimed author of horror, weird, and sentimental fiction. Hailed by Publishers Weekly as "A perfect balance between the bizarre and the straight-forward" and Library Journal as "One of the most distinctive voices in imaginative literature," Steve Rasnic Tem has been read and cherished the world over for his affecting, genre-crossing tales. Dark Moon Books and editor Eric J. Guignard bring you this introduction to his work, the first in a series of primers exploring modern masters of literary dark short fiction. Herein is a chance to discover-or learn more of-the rich voice of Steve Rasnic Tem, as beautifully illustrated by artist Michelle Prebich.
